pollinizer Definition
a plant that is used to provide pollen to another plant in order to fertilize it.

Summary: pollinizer in Brief
'Pollinizer' [ˈpɑːlɪnaɪzər] refers to a plant that provides pollen to another plant for fertilization. It is commonly used in agriculture to increase crop yield, as seen in 'The farmer planted a few pollinizer plants to ensure proper pollination.'
